原文:Spring源码分析(三)容器核心类

摘要:本文结合 Spring源码深度解析 来分析Spring . . 版本的源代码。若有描述错误之处,欢迎指正。 在上一篇文章中,我们熟悉了容器的基本用法。在这一篇,我们开始分析Spring的源码。但是在正式开始熟悉源码之前,有必要了解一下Spring中最核心的两个类。 .DefaultListableBeanFactory XmlBeanFactory继承自DefaultListableBea ...

2018-07-26 21:18 0 1695 推荐指数:

查看详情

Spring IOC容器核心流程源码分析

简单介绍 Spring IOC的核心方法就在于refresh方法,这个方法里面完成了Spring的初始化、准备bean、实例化bean和扩展功能的实现。 这个方法的作用是什么? 它是如何完成这些功能的? 为什么要这样去实现? 有哪些值得借鉴的地方? refresh方法 ...

Tue Aug 17 01:11:00 CST 2021 0 234
dedecms核心源码分析

dedecms核心源码分析    最近公司一个cms类型的项目,时间紧任务重。经过快速的决策后,选择了dedecms开发1.0版本,满足基本需求。以前从来没有接触过这个系统,而且此系统文档是相当的不全。所以分析源代码是最好的方式。学习一个系统,首要的是搞懂它的数据引擎、模板引擎 ...

Fri Nov 02 01:18:00 CST 2018 0 765
基于注解的Spring容器源码分析

spring3.0版本引入注解容器类之后,Spring注解的使用就变得异常的广泛起来,到如今流行的SpringBoot中,几乎是全部使用了注解。Spring的常用注解有很多,有@Bean,@Compont,@Autowired等。这些注解的使用和基于xml文件的使用的方式如出一辙 ...

Tue Apr 17 07:59:00 CST 2018 0 1045
Spring IOC 容器源码分析

Spring 最重要的概念是 IOC 和 AOP,本篇文章其实就是要带领大家来分析Spring 的 IOC 容器。既然大家平时都要用到 Spring,怎么可以不好好了解 Spring 呢?阅读本文并不能让你成为 Spring 专家,不过一定有助于大家理解 Spring 的很多概念,帮助大家排查 ...

Tue Apr 21 08:18:00 CST 2020 1 535
Spring源码分析(二)容器基本用法

摘要:本文结合《Spring源码深度解析》来分析Spring 5.0.6版本的源代码。若有描述错误之处,欢迎指正。 在正式分析Spring源码之前,我们有必要先来回顾一下Spring中最简单的用法。尽管我相信您已经对这个例子非常熟悉了。 Bean是Spring中最核心的概念 ...

Fri Jul 27 02:07:00 CST 2018 0 1684
SpringSpring核心容器

Spring核心容器 文章目录 Spring核心容器 BeanFactory ApplicationContext 1.通过ClassPathXmlApplicationContext创建 2. ...

Fri Feb 14 07:09:00 CST 2020 0 741
MapStruct生成实现对象的Spring容器对象属性注入问题源码分析

本文解析MapStruct生成继承Spring容器对象属性注入为空问题,并分析了相关源码。给出了一个Spring容器对象属性正确注入例子。 在领域模型中经常会遇到对象属性的拷贝,对属性的手动赋值会增加不必要的工作量,而使用BeanUtils.copyProperties等工具存在 ...

Mon Sep 07 05:56:00 CST 2020 0 3458
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M